Output dcbee2be207b6033fc54d23e7ca4e4de182cd7aa8c76aeb150924fe1d7dd46a8:0

value
130713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2837557759244caeebe496449eaa3cfe7911321a OP_EQUAL
address
35MfEt22tnxKbjtVLqPeK1NhndTKrXUMm2
transaction
dcbee2be207b6033fc54d23e7ca4e4de182cd7aa8c76aeb150924fe1d7dd46a8
confirmations
270093
spent
true